68.01 percent of the population in 20877 drive to work alone. 9.32 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 47.45 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 17.30 percent of the residents in 20877 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.76 members with about 1.97 cars available per household.
An estimate of 82.02 percent of the residents in 20877 has some form of health insurance. 36.13 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 55.68 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 20877 would have to travel an average of 2.73 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Adventist Healthcare Shady Grove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 20877, Gaithersburg, Maryland.

As of , an estimate of 37,094 residents live in 20877 with a median age of 37.6 years. 22.97 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 14.94 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 38.33 percent of the residents in 20877 is currently married, and 22.58 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 20877 is $6,707.50.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 20877 is approximately $1,783. The median household spends about 26.58 percent of their income on housing.

Hypertension, also known as high blood pressure, is a common condition that can lead to serious health complications if left untreated. It is defined as having a consistently elevated blood pressure higher than 130/80 mmHg.
